Introduction of Concrete Admixture Polycarboxylic Superplasticizer

Polycarboxylate water-reducing agent, which belongs to the category of high-performance water-reducing agent, is a concrete additive based on polycarboxylic acid polymer. It uses the carboxylic acid groups in the molecular structure to interact physically and chemically with cement particles to effectively disperse the cement particles, thereby significantly reducing water consumption without reducing the fluidity of concrete. Polycarboxylate superplasticizer has become one of the most commonly used admixtures in modern high-performance concrete due to its excellent dispersion properties, wide adaptability to cement, and environmentally friendly properties.
Advantages of Concrete Admixture Polycarboxylic Superplasticizer

Super dispersion: Compared with traditional water reducing agents, polycarboxylate water reducing agents can disperse cement particles more effectively and improve the fluidity and pumpability of concrete.

High water reduction rate: It can significantly reduce the water-cement ratio. Usually the water reduction rate can reach more than 25%, which helps to improve the strength of concrete.

Good workability: Even at low water-cement ratios, concrete can maintain good workability and is easy to pour and form.

Strong adaptability: It has good adaptability to various types of cement and is not easily affected by environmental changes.

Green and environmentally friendly: It does not contain chloride ions, is non-corrosive to steel bars, and has little pollution during the production process, meeting the requirements of sustainable development.

Improved durability of concrete: Reduce porosity and improve concrete’s resistance to permeability, freeze-thaw resistance, and chemical erosion resistance.

Application of Concrete Admixture Polycarboxylic Superplasticizer

High-rise buildings and infrastructure: widely used in large-scale buildings and bridge projects that require high strength and durability.

Prestressed concrete and precast components: Improve the fluidity and early strength of concrete to facilitate the production of precast components.

Large-volume concrete construction: effectively control temperature rise and reduce cracks, suitable for large-volume concrete pouring in hydropower stations, nuclear power plants, etc.

Repair and reinforcement projects: In the repair of old concrete structures, improve the bonding strength of the interface between new and old concrete.

Special environmental engineering: In harsh environments such as offshore engineering and saline-alkali land, its corrosion resistance can be used to improve the durability of concrete.


5 FAQs about Concrete Admixture Polycarboxylic Superplasticizer

Q: Does Concrete Admixture Polycarboxylic Superplasticizer affect the color of concrete?

Answer: Normally, polycarboxylate superplasticizer will not change the natural color of concrete.


Q: What is the recommended dosage of Concrete Admixture Polycarboxylic Superplasticizer?

Answer: The addition amount is generally 0.15% to 0.4% of the cement weight, which is adjusted according to the concrete mix ratio and performance requirements.


Q: Can using Concrete Admixture Polycarboxylic Superplasticizer extend the setting time of concrete?

Answer: Some polycarboxylate superplasticizers contain retardant components, which can moderately adjust the setting time, but not all products have this effect.


Q: Is Concrete Admixture Polycarboxylic Superplasticizer suitable for all types of cement?

Answer: Concrete Admixture Polycarboxylic Superplasticizer has a wide range of cement adaptability, but different cements may need to adjust the type or amount of superplasticizer to achieve the best effect.


Q: Does Concrete Admixture Polycarboxylic Superplasticizer have any effect on the shrinkage of concrete?

Answer: Appropriate use usually does not significantly increase the shrinkage of concrete, but excessive water reduction may slightly increase drying shrinkage. Pay attention to the balance of the formula.
